he main road in front of Jakarta City Hall will be closed on Saturday and Sunday for Jakarnaval (Jakarta carnival), continuing the festivities for Jakarta’s anniversary.
According to a circular sent out by the Jakarta administration on Thursday, the south side of Jl. Merdeka Selatan, which is in front of City Hall, is to be closed on Saturday for rehearsals from 3 p.m. to 6 p.m.
On Saturday, vehicles from Jl. Ridwan Rais going left to Jl. Medan Merdeka Selatan are to be redirected to go straight to Jl. Medan Merdeka Timur.
Meanwhile, motorists who want to make U-turns from the north side of Jl. Medan Merdeka Selatan to the south side are to be diverted toward Jl. Ridwan Rais or Jl. Medan Merdeka Timur.
During Jakarnaval on Sunday, more streets are to be closed from 3 p.m. to 6 p.m. At these times, both the north and south sides of Jl. Medan Merdeka Selatan are to be closed, along with the Bank Indonesia traffic circle, as the carnival participants march around the area.
The east side of Jl. MH Thamrin starting from the Bank Indonesia traffic circle toward the Hotel Indonesia traffic circle is to be closed as it is to be the route used by decorative carnival vehicles.
Meanwhile, Jl. Imam Bonjol from the Hotel Indonesia traffic circle going toward Jl. Agus Salim junction is to also be closed.
Traffic diversions are to happen in the following areas:
Vehicles from Jl. Medan Merdeka Barat going toward the Bank Indonesia traffic circle must make a U-turn in front of the National Museum.
Meanwhile, those traveling from Jl. Imam Bonjol toward the Hotel Indonesia traffic circle can take a left toward Jl. Pameksaan.
Both sides of Jl. Wahid Hasyim and Jl. Kebon Sirih, as well as Jl. Budi Kemuliaan, are to experience situational road closures as they await the carnival party to disperse.
Furthermore, people who wish to attend the event can park their vehicles in the National Monument (Monas) parking lot, Park and Ride Thamrin 10, Jl. Imam Bonjol roadsides and Plaza Mandiri.
The Jakarta Transportation Agency advised motorists to avoid the carnival area during the event to avoid traffic congestion. (eyc)
